Latest Patents

Pnina Amir holds one patent that includes several varieties designated as 'NGT-15-5000', 'NGT-17-7039', 'NGT-18-7090', and 'NGT-18-3080'. This invention relates specifically to plants and seeds of these new varieties. It encompasses the various parts of the plants, including cells and any propagative material, which can be utilized for reproducing these varieties. Furthermore, her patent covers methods for deriving new varieties from the plant parts of 'NGT-15-5000', 'NGT-17-7039', 'NGT-18-7090', and 'NGT-18-3080', as well as the seeds and plants produced by crossing them with other varieties.
